This oxtail soup is made with lots of love.

“Tail” is the well-known tail of a cow. When you bite into the bone-in meat, the meat around the bone gives it a luxurious taste, just like corned beef.

The elegant and flavorful soup contains plenty of coriander and has a rich aroma.

Also, if you mix the chopped ginger and soy sauce that is brought to the table and soak the meat in it, the flavor will be even more delicious.

Asahi Grill, famous for its oxtail soup, has moved here from Keamoku.
It seems that the owner of Ward changed and the taste changed, and this store seems to have the original taste.
If you are Japanese, I think a mini version is fine unless you want to share it.
From Waikiki, take the number 13 bus past Market City, go down H1, and get off at the first bus stop, and you'll see it right away.

I entered the store as soon as it opened at 17:00, and it was filled with local customers one after another.

My husband and I shared oxtail soup and short rib fried rice, and my son ordered a cheeseburger.

The oxtail soup is without coriander, the white or brown rice in the set is white rice, and the eggs in the fried rice are scrambled? Order at.

After about 5 to 10 minutes of waiting, the soup and fried rice arrived. The oxtail soup is served in a large bowl with lots of tails. I had the cilantro removed, but the ginger scent was strong and the taste was very refreshing.

The fried rice was lightly stir-fried and had plenty of ribs in it, so it tasted more like American rice than Japanese rice.

The cheeseburger was big enough to make you feel like it was a local dish, and the atmosphere of the restaurant had a nostalgic feel to it, rather than the atmosphere of a restaurant in a tourist area, so I really enjoyed it.

However, the two scoops of rice that came with the fried rice cooled down quickly due to the cool interior of the restaurant, and the rice was a bit hard, making it crumbly compared to Japanese rice and I couldn't finish it all. I think the correct answer was to dip it in the soup and eat it.

However, the long-awaited soup and fried rice were absolutely delicious!
